Использовать утилиту xp_cmdshell и bcp не работает - PullRequest
0 голосов
/ 26 февраля 2020

Запуск этих на SQL сервере 2014 SP3

EXE C master..xp_cmdshell 'dir c: \' - это работает

** в одной строке **

EXE C master..xp_cmdshell 'bcp "выберите имя, type_des c, create_date из sys.objects" queryout "c: \ bcptest2.txt" -T -Sbl3c0b \ switch2014 - c -t, '- Это не работает

Я успешно запустил bcp из командной строки, но при использовании xp_cmdshell он вообще не работает.

Я уже выполнил следующее

EXE C master.dbo.sp_configure 'Показать дополнительные параметры', 1

RECONFIGURE

EXE C master.dbo.sp_configure ' xp_cmdshell ', 1

RECONFIGURE

Спасибо!

1 Ответ

0 голосов
/ 26 февраля 2020

Из дома по VPN она не работала, но когда я добралась до сети рабочей зоны моей компании, она заработала.

Я не знаю почему, но, по крайней мере, она работает, как и ожидалось.

...